Bathco BM Torrelavega presented its project for the 2023/2024 season yesterday morning, corresponding to the first ASOBAL Professional League. The presentation included a press conference held at the headquarters of Bathco, the main sponsor of the orange squad, in an event that is already a true tradition of Torrelavega's preseasons.
The event featured the participation of José López, manager of Bathco; Susana Ruiz, Director General of Sports; Javier López Estrada, Mayor of Torrelavega; and Antonio Gómez and Álex Mozas, president and coach of Bathco BM Torrelavega. Alongside the economic and management aspects of the project, the sports objectives for this year dominated the conversation.
After an initial assessment by Antonio Gómez, Álex Mozas took the floor to analyze the upcoming season. True to his philosophy since arriving in Torrelavega 6 years ago, Mozas focused on “improving last season's results, that sixth place with 32 points that we achieved.” Furthermore, after praising the new signings, he emphasized the role of the youth academy in this preseason. “These have been very tough weeks due to injuries, but players like Carlos, Fernando, Pedro, or Diego are contributing a lot,” stated Mozas, also indicating that “almost all these players are from Cantabria, continuing to develop this youth academy is another of our objectives.”.
Raising his bet from last season, José López has established “getting into Europe” as the “main objective for this season.” The Bathco manager already hinted at these intentions last season, although he admitted that “it was a goal we were dreaming of until the end, despite all the adversities we suffered.”.
Both the Director General of Sport and the Mayor of Torrelavega have expressed themselves along the same lines. Susana Ruiz highlighted “the region's pride in having a team fighting for such high achievements.” For his part, López Estrada emphasized the club's work beyond the 40x20 court, “with exemplary values, a very large youth academy, a wonderful Corporate Social Responsibility plan, and furthermore, being the club in Torrelavega with the most members, exceeding 1,000 at this point.”.
